09.
A meatball lover's paradise.
08.
Where meatball subs meet mouth-watering magic.
07.
Where every bite is a meatball masterpiece!
06.
Meatball madness in every bite!
05.
A meatball sub paradise.
04.
Where every bite is a meatball party.
03.
Where every bite of their meatball subs is like a little slice of Italian heaven!